Men’s Cross Country Takes First at Haskell Invite, Women Finish Third

LAWRENCE, Kan. – With a total time of 25:38.85, the Baker men's cross country team won the 8K Haskell Invite, while the women's team placed third in the 6K race to give the Wildcats a pair of top-three finishes at the Saturday morning meet, held in Lawrence, Kan.

The men's team totaled 65 points to finish ahead of runner-up Rockhurst (68) and fellow Heart of America teams Park (90) and Central Methodist (91).

Anthony Davis paced the Wildcats after clocking a personal-best 26:20.09 to place fifth, while three other Wildcats finished among the top-15 with Zain Khan (26:49.58) and Chris Jackson (27:00.30) crossing back-to-back in 10th and 11th and freshman Davin Johnson (27:15.24) coming in 15th. Wyatt Allen (27:41.85) was the final point-scorer for BU after finishing in 24th.

The women's squad finished with 58 points, same as Rockhurst, but the Hawks won the tie-breaker to earn runner-up honors.

Brooke Allen picked up a fourth-place finish on a 6K time of 23:24.30 to lead the Wildcats. Haley Carter (23:41.23) and Peyton Petersen (24:14.26) were next to cross for Baker with Carter coming in ninth and Petersen in 13th. Jana Landreth (24:29.83) and Kristi Chambers (24:34.99) rounded out the scoring in a solid all-around performance from the Wildcats.

Baker will close out the regular-season portion of its 2023 campaign by hosting the Mike Spielman Classic on Friday, Oct. 20 at 5 p.m. out at the Baldwin City Golf Course in Baldwin City.
